Southern Comfort is quite sweet, therefore it has sugar in it and therefore wouldn't be fructose free. David did say that liqueur drinks are a no no.
In time, with being sugar free, you will lose the taste for sweet drinks and will find SC too sweet for you. Also, with artificial sweeteners, they are not at all healthy anyway and have the same effect on insulin in our bodies as sugar, they raise it and make us want to eat more.
If you can replace your drink with something else.............I have soda water with a squeeze of lemon, which satisfies me, but you will, I'm sure find your own replacement.
